Homecoming Lyrics by Stylus (Raymond Mowla)

The 20/20 Album

Chorus
Are you ready when the Son of Man is coming back for you?
Are you ready for the earth to roar when all will be made new?
Are you ready ‘cause the prophets and the seers tell the truth?
Be ready!
Be ready!

Verse 1
I’m sittin’ here awaitin’ the King’s return
These wild streets gotta learn
He sent the fire as the sancti-fier – you gon’ burn
You a liar if you claim the Messiah was not born
And then raisеd on the third and ascended back to His homе
He’s like “feed the sheep”, and go seek the streets
In the highways and bi-ways - where else they gon’ be?
I’m like “hear me sir, this whole plans absurd
Plus these dudes steady deke’n me like I’m the nerd"
He’s like, “Pay the price for my sacrifice
I know it looks like they winnin’ but I’m the Author of Life!
Even when the Son shines they be walkin’ in night
I know these dudes don’t believe in me – and they not that bright
But I called you to speak for me – and flash that light
Let these tunes keep revealin’ Me – and smash that hype
Cause these preachers who speak for Me have lost that vibe
There’s no passion for ministry – They’re not that type"
I’m so glad you’re a friend to me – although I was an enemy
I love you ‘cause You love first – that’s what my pen would bleed
And til’ my dyin’ day - or the last breath that exits me
I be spittin’ these facts til’ the world knows the mission be
Preach the Gospel and clothe the poor
Cause the time’s getting short before these prison doors
Slam close and the liar and his deeds exposed
There’s no stairway to heaven that’s why Jesus rose

Chorus
Are you ready when the Son of Man is coming back for you?
Are you ready for the earth to roar when all will be made new?
Are you ready ‘cause the prophets and the seers tell the truth?
Be ready!
Be ready!

Verse 2
It’s one thing for you to doubt that King
Another thing if you ‘bout that sin -
Like you don’t comprehend the beef that brings
Gotta mortify the flesh; it’s a deeper cleanse
Than just changin’ up ya dress; it’s beneath the skin
I know there’s many who impress, but the One who reigns says:
To steady up ya mess and truly beat this thing
You gotta crucify the flesh and renew ya dome
There’s too many who profess who never make it home
He has left you with a gift to help you move in power
Stay planted next to streams and then you’ll bloom like flowers
Then remember how He rose and overcame that coward
The devil doesn’t have a move unless you choose to bow
Try to focus on the pure and take your shield to stand
Move wise among these wolves as you pass through these lands
And remember that our hope is in a foreign place
A Kingdom reached by faith when we receive His grace

Chorus
Are you ready when the Son of Man is coming back for you?
Be ready!
Be ready!
